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 1. “O Lord, remember what happened to us; Look upon us with favor And see our disgrace.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 2. Our inheritance has been turned over to foreigners, And our homes to strangers.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 3. We have become orphans and have no father; Our mothers are as widows.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 4. “We pay for the water we drink, And our wood comes at a price.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 5. We are pursued at our heels; We have labored; We have no rest.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 6. Egypt gave us a hand, Assyria to their satisfaction.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 7. “Our fathers sinned and are no more; We suffered from their lawless actions.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 8. Servants rule over us; There is no one to redeem us from their hand.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 9. We will bring in our bread At the risk of our lives From the presence of the sword in the desert.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 10. “Our skin has became blackened as an oven. They are shriveled up from the stormy wind of famine.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 11. They humbled the women in Zion, The virgins in the cities of Judah.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 12. Princes were hung up by their hands, And elders were not honored.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 13. The chosen men took up weeping, And the young men weakened under the loads of wood.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 14. Elders also ceased to gather at the gate; The chosen men ceased to sing their psalms.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 15. “The joy of our heart has ceased; Our dance has turned into mourning.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 16. The crown fell from our head; Woe to us, because we sinned!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 17. Because of this, our heart has become painful; Because of this, our eyes have remained in darkness.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 18. On Mount Zion, because it is desolate, Foxes pass through it.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 19. “But You, O Lord, shall dwell forever, Your throne from generation to generation.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 20. Why will You utterly forget us? Will You forsake us for so long a time?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 21. Turn us back to You, O Lord, And we shall be converted; Renew our days as before. Lamentations of Jeremiah 5, verse 22. For You have indeed rejected us, And are exceedingly angry with us.”
